Mute Conversations

There often arise instances when you do not wish to indulge in a conversation anymore with another individual. Besides this, ignoring constant pop-up alerts of annoying promotional messages can become overwhelming. 

Thankfully, iOS’s native Messages app offers users a simple and easy method following which they can stop getting pestered by alerts or notifications of irrelevant messages. To hide alerts of a specific conversation, you must swipe left over the conversation you wish to mute and tap on the “Alerts” button. 

Doing so will mute all alerts from that particular conversation. If you wish to unmute them at any point, all you need to do is swipe left again and tap on the bell-resembling icon. Muting conversations on the Messages app of iPhones is a simple and easy way to avoid or ignore conversation alerts.

Recover Deleted Messages

Even though deleting conversations from the Messages app requires multiple steps, you may regret deleting them afterward. However, if you wish to recover the deleted conversation on your iPhone, there are numerous ways following which you can retrieve or restore it. 

For starters, if you have backed up your Messages data on iCloud, you can access it and restore any deleted conversation without hassle. Besides this, you can see your iPhone’s deleted messages using your Mac’s Finder and iTunes application. All you need to do is connect your iPhone to your Mac and open the Finder or iTunes application. 

In the Finder app, click on your device’s name under Locations and restore any backup present. Similarly, if you wish to access deleted messages using iTunes, open the app, click on the phone icon and restore the backup if there is any. Besides this, you can also use a third-party tool like AnyTrans to restore messages. Share Location

Location sharing is an easy way for users to share their exact whereabouts with others. Many iPhone users do not know that they do not need to use a third-party messaging application to share their location with others, i.eThey can conveniently do it using the Messages application. 

If you wish to share your location with a contact, open the Messages app, navigate the individual’s conversation with whom you wish to share your location, tap on their profile picture followed by the “info” option, scroll down and tap on the “Share My Location” option to get the job done. 

You also get the option to select the duration for which you wish to share your location. Once you use the feature, a link to Apple Maps will be forwarded to the contact, along with a pin showing your exact location.

Disable Read Receipts

Read receipts signify whether the person whom you have messaged has seen or read your messages or not. Some people prefer turning the feature on since it allows them to see who has read their messages and vice versa. 

However, if you fall in the category of people who wish to stay lowkey and wish to disable your Messages app’s read receipts feature, you can conveniently do so by opening the Messages tab in the Settings utility, tapping on the “Send Read Receipts” option and toggling the switch into the off position.
